๐ Key Features Comparison: Samsung Galaxy F55 5G vs Moto Edge 50 Fusion
๐ฅ๏ธ Display
The Samsung Galaxy F55 5G boasts a 6.7-inch Super AMOLED display with Full HD+ resolution and a buttery smooth 120Hz refresh rate. On the other hand, the Moto Edge 50 Fusion matches that with a slightly larger 6.8-inch pOLED panel, also offering Full HD+ resolution and a 120Hz refresh rate. While both displays deliver stunning visuals, Samsungโs AMOLED tech has a slight edge in color vibrancy. ๐
๐ Battery Life
The Galaxy F55 packs a 5000mAh battery with 25W fast charging, ensuring a full day of use with ease. Meanwhile, the Moto Edge 50 Fusion carries a slightly smaller 4800mAh battery but takes the lead with blazing-fast 68W charging. โก If fast charging is your priority, Moto wins this round!
โ๏ธ Performance
Under the hood, the Galaxy F55 features the Exynos 1380 chipset, while the Moto Edge 50 Fusion is powered by the more powerful Snapdragon 7 Gen 1 processor. For gaming and multitasking, the Snapdragon processor offers better performance and efficiency. ๐ฎ
๐ธ Camera
Both phones flaunt impressive camera setups. The Galaxy F55 has a 108MP + 8MP + 2MP rear camera system and a 32MP selfie shooter. Meanwhile, the Moto Edge 50 Fusion sports a 50MP + 13MP + 2MP rear combo and a 32MP front camera. While Motoโs ultrawide lens does better in versatility, Samsung shines with its high-megapixel sensor for detailed shots. ๐ทโจ
โก Charging Features
Samsung offers 25W charging, which is decent but falls behind Motoโs ultra-fast 68W charging that gets you up and running in no time. Moto clearly takes the crown in this department. ๐
๐ Comparison Table: Samsung Galaxy F55 5G vs Moto Edge 50 Fusion
| Feature | Samsung Galaxy F55 5G | Moto Edge 50 Fusion |
|---|---|---|
| Display | 6.7-inch Super AMOLED, 120Hz | 6.8-inch pOLED, 120Hz |
| Battery | 5000mAh, 25W charging | 4800mAh, 68W charging |
| Processor | Exynos 1380 | Snapdragon 7 Gen 1 |
| Rear Camera | 108MP + 8MP + 2MP | 50MP + 13MP + 2MP |
| Front Camera | 32MP | 32MP |
| Price | โน25,999 | โน27,999 |
๐ Pros and Cons
Samsung Galaxy F55 5G
- Pros: Vibrant AMOLED display, long battery life, excellent primary camera.
- Cons: Slower charging, slightly weaker processor.
Moto Edge 50 Fusion
- Pros: Faster charging, powerful Snapdragon processor, versatile camera setup.
- Cons: Slightly smaller battery, higher price.
๐ Final Conclusion: Which One Should You Buy?
If you prioritize a stunning display and a high-resolution primary camera, the Samsung Galaxy F55 5G is a fantastic choice. However, if youโre looking for faster charging, better performance, and a versatile camera, the Moto Edge 50 Fusion is the way to go.
